From 0897423423ea2704abdfd35dc58065d12d9f7386 Mon Sep 17 00:00:00 2001 From: NeilBrown Date: Sat, 20 Nov 2021 11:50:55 +1100 Subject: [PATCH] oceani: record if a variable declaration was given an explicit type The type may be determined at the same place as the declaration, yet still not be explicit. To ensure correct output when printing code, record what was found.
